Is there a difference between applying a conditional tag to a TOC topic (select a topic in the TOC and apply tag) and applying it to the topic itself (Select the topic from the topic list or select the condition option in the topic properties.)?

Yes there is a difference. If a CBT is applied to a TOC topic, the topic will not appear in the TOC but (and it is a big but) the topic is still included in the output. It will be searchable. If a CBT is applied to a topic (e.g. via the topic list pod) it will not be included in the output and therefore also not in the TOC.
